( Continued from page 1.) ganization. 1h limited to those who bo came reaJdontB of Nebraska, or whose parentH-beoanie-reHldenta-xJLNeblaaka. prior to March lut, 18C7. The member ship fee Is . The organization haB no paid officers or employees. The headquarters of both organiza tions for registration and the Issuance of certificates, will be maintained at the rooms of the historical society In the Mbrary building of the Universi ty, whore all who come will be wel come. If you are a member of either organization send your name to the secretary, and advise him whether nv j not you expect to bo present. Invlta- ! l.. ,.,111 l. I .-! t.. ..., yuun mil IJU lamil'U III cine uniu 10 those who are members of the society, but all others are Just as cordially in vited, especially the pioneers. All communications should be addressed to Clarence S. Paine, secretary, Sta tion A, Lincoln, Neb. Ueth Stone, nn artlsllc toe dancer, recently with "The Little Cherub" company, in which Hattle Williams is starring, heads the bill at tho Lyric thiB week. Sho Is one or the best at tractions that has beon seen here on the vaudeville stago this season. Clay ton and Jenkins, with their mule in a circus bhrlesquo, please the audiences. Moores, G. A. P. D., Wabash R. R., Omaha, Neb. MWHHJiL Nebraska will meet the Muscallne, Iowa, basket-ball live In the first game of the local season Saturday evening, January 11. A basket-ball informal will follow the game. Muscatine has one or the strongest fives In the -country. J The fourth students' recital or the University School or Music will be given Wednesday evening January 8th, at 8 o'clock in the University Temple. Students are cordially Invited.
